DIN-rail enclosure expands capacity by 30%

Camden Electronics has added a new size 12 enclosure to its versatile modular DIN rail mounting range offering 30% extra capacity.

A logical addition to the range, the new CNMB/12 snap-fit DIN-rail enclosure is 210 mm long compared with 160 mm for the CNMB/9. The additional length allows users to include larger electronic printed circuits in a single enclosure.

The new enclosure is supplied complete with 12 terminal guards as standard, eight perforated on 5,08 mm pitch and four solid. A vented option is also available for applications requiring additional heat dissipation.

With the addition of the CNMB/12, a total of eight versions is currently available offering lengths of 17,5, 36, 53, 71, 88, 106, 160 and 210 mm, all 90 mm wide.

Offering greater versatility, Camden’s design features PCB guides to ensure boards are held in place firmly and moulded screw holes in the base to facilitate mounting of PCBs with heavier components such as relays or transformers. Up to three PCBs can be mounted horizontally while there are four mounting positions for vertical boards.

In addition, the enclosure base is fully sealed with none of the holes that are found on competing products, avoiding the need for any insulating pads and reducing assembly costs for users. The design of the enclosure is such that all tabs on the body have been eliminated to avoid small lugs that might break off.

Standard colour is grey (RAL7035), although Camden can also supply mouldings in black, green, red or blue for volume orders. In addition, ventilation slots and other features can be incorporated in the tooling for volume customers who wish to avoid the need for machining. Besides reducing costs for the end user this facility also results in a stronger moulding compared with a similar enclosure with machined ventilation slots.

Additional special features include snap-on terminal covers to IP20 finger protection with perforated screwdriver and wire entry holes and tabs as standard and spring-loaded DIN-rail clips that can be snapped open to allow chassis/surface mounting. Terminal covers and snap-in panels can be provided to customer specifications for volume orders.

Other optional special features include EMI-shielded metallic coated boxes. Camden can also supply an optional adapter for G-rail mounting.
